The Sweden Electrochemical Glass Market is experiencing steady growth driven by increasing demand for smart glass in various applications such as automotive, construction, and electronics. The market is characterized by the presence of key players like SageGlass, Chromogenics, and View Inc., who are investing in research and development to enhance product offerings. Smart glass technology, which allows for control over light transmission and heat insulation, is gaining popularity in energy-efficient building designs and automotive applications. The market is also witnessing a trend towards sustainable and eco-friendly solutions, with electrochromic glass being favored for its energy-saving properties. Overall, the Sweden Electrochemical Glass Market is poised for continued growth, fueled by technological advancements and the need for energy-efficient solutions in various sectors.

In the Sweden Electrochemical Glass Market, some challenges faced include limited consumer awareness and understanding of the technology, high initial costs of installation, and relatively slow adoption rates compared to other energy-efficient technologies. Additionally, the market faces competition from alternative smart glass technologies and conventional window solutions. Regulatory barriers and building code requirements may also hinder the widespread adoption of electrochemical glass in Sweden. To overcome these challenges, stakeholders in the market need to focus on increasing awareness through targeted marketing efforts, offering incentives or subsidies to reduce upfront costs, and working closely with policymakers to streamline regulations and standards for incorporating electrochemical glass in buildings.
